Transaction 66b2ed31987eb2e01cb0f0970436caa7726ebdc98acba3994d263a77cbb649a5
1 Input
1 Output
-
66b2ed31987eb2e01cb0f0970436caa7726ebdc98acba3994d263a77cbb649a5:0
- value
- 10284306
- script pubkey
- OP_0 OP_PUSHBYTES_32 594caa7add8ae8f579af02fdd44d3da90c6ed1d41f7529341ceb17d585a5f2f0
- address
- bc1qt9x257ka3t5027d0qt7agnfa4yxxa5w5ra6jjdquavtatpd97tcq7l9qg7